We Tested Solar Fence Lights Through Rainstorms—These Were the Brightest

Solar fence lights are a popular choice for enhancing the ambiance and safety of outdoor spaces such as lawns, gardens, pools, and patios, as they operate by converting captured sunlight into light, eliminating the need for cords or power cables. This review details the testing of nine different solar fence lights over three weeks, including their performance in various weather conditions, to identify the best options available. The evaluation considered factors such as installation ease, appearance, light quality, functionality, and overall value, alongside insights from an outdoor lighting expert on key purchasing considerations. Leading the selection is the Doeslag Solar Fence Lights With Edison Bulbs, praised for its subtle, warm glow, classic aesthetic, and flexible installation. These lights, which come in an eight-pack, feature black plastic housing and Edison-style bulbs, providing a traditional look. They are designed to sit flush with the fence, making them suitable for diverse fence types, and were noted for their ability to fully charge and illuminate from dusk till dawn, even enduring severe weather. While their plastic housing raised some durability concerns, their overall performance and style made them the top choice. The Solpex Horizontal Warm White Solar Deck Lights Set earned the 'Best Bang For The Buck' title due to its affordability and ease of installation. This 16-pack offers a soft, warm glow, ideal for common recreational areas, and demonstrated reliable charging and operation even during extended cloudy and rainy periods. For those seeking decorative lighting, the Brightown Solar Fairy Lights are highlighted for their ability to add instant ambiance. These lights, which include a small solar panel capable of powering them for up to 10 hours, offer eight different lighting effects and flexible installation methods, though tangling during horizontal installation was noted. The Dynaming Flickering Flame Solar Post Cap Lights were chosen as the best cap lights, offering an effective way to illuminate paths or backyards with a flickering flame effect. These lights are durable and provide soft, ambient light, although the quality of the included screws was a minor drawback. The Zookki Solar Outdoor Lights were recognized as the best motion-sensor lights, providing 400 lumens of bright illumination, sensitive motion detection up to 26 feet, and an IP65 weather-resistant rating, making them ideal for security purposes, though their brightness might be excessive for some. Other notable lights include the Derynome Solar Lantern Outdoor Lights, favored for their sturdy glass and stainless steel construction and warm light output, perfect for patios and garden areas. The Melunar 6-Pack Solar Deck Lights were selected for their color-changing capabilities, offering both warm white and dynamic color options, although their assembly required considerable effort. The Aootek New Solar Motion-Sensor Lights, with 500 lumens and a wide 120-degree sensing angle, were rated as the best wide-angle option, providing three distinct modes for versatile use. Finally, the Brightech Ambience Pro Solar String Lights, featuring shatterproof Edison-style bulbs, provide a vintage aesthetic and bright, even illumination, proving resilient in various weather conditions. The testing methodology involved evaluating approximately 20 products, focusing on weather resistance, brightness, color, and additional features, with a special emphasis on positive customer feedback. Each selected light was installed and tested for at least three weeks, enduring heavy rain and windstorms to assess durability and performance. The article also provides a comprehensive guide on selecting solar fence lights, covering aspects like type (motion-activated, timer-controlled, dusk-to-dawn), battery life, recharging time, brightness (lumens), color temperature (kelvins), and IP ratings for weather resistance, advising on optimal choices for different needs and climates. Routine maintenance, such as cleaning solar panels, is also recommended to ensure longevity and efficiency. Most solar lights are designed to charge even when turned off and typically hold a charge for 6 to 12 hours, with quality lights lasting up to ten years, though batteries may need replacement after 3 to 5 years.
